Output 31a71884d7b7237a059aa134c0750aac1471ec196c99f10af061e1250106684d:12

value
148248110
script pubkey
OP_0 OP_PUSHBYTES_32 ddc53c01bb16d5c06ad001c7a4a2f14be4ba10505c1e348d87a9daa6769dfdac
address
bc1qmhzncqdmzm2uq6ksq8r6fgh3f0jt5yzsts0rfrv848d2va5alkkq34sccc
transaction
31a71884d7b7237a059aa134c0750aac1471ec196c99f10af061e1250106684d
spent
true